Let’s make some healthy oatmeal cookies! Are you on a healthy diet and feel like having a snack sometimes? Then let's learn how to make oatmeal cookies. This oatmeal cookie recipe can be made for a great breakfast item or a quick on the go snack.
The base of the cookies are oatmeal which makes it a healthy cookie. Why would I want to make oatmeal cookies you ask? Instead of flour that consists of mainly just carbs, Oats are packed with fiber which makes it a great substitute for a snack. These oatmeal cookies are soft and chewy with nice warm spices.
Oat cookies are not hard to make. These oatmeal cookies don't require any butter so they are low in fat. You can adjust the sweetness of the cookie by adding your desired amount of sugar. Since I wanted a healthy cookie I added limited sugar. You could also use sugar substitutes like Stevia if you prefer.
I will show you the basics on how to make oatmeal cookies from scratch. Feel free to adjust the recipe to your likings and to make it more yummy you can add some of your favorite cookie filling like chocolate, nuts or dried fruit! These cookies are very versatile. Add some Chocolate chips to make chocolate chip oatmeal cookies. Or replace the applesauce with peanut butter to make peanut butter oatmeal cookies!

Applesauce Cookies
These delicious homemade applesauce cookies are a perfect treat! Made with brown sugar, applesauce, spices, and topped with a made from scratch cream cheese frosting, this simple cookie recipe is moist and flavorful.

Ingredients
Cookies:
2½ cups all-purpose flour
1 cup light brown sugar
½ cup unsalted butter room temperature
2 eggs room temperature
¾ cup Musselman's Cinnamon Applesauce
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on apple pie spice blend
½ teaspoon baking soda
½ teaspoon salt
Icing:
8 ounces cream cheese room temperature
1 cup powdered sugar
1 tablespoon half & half (or whole milk)
½ teaspoon vanilla extract
Garnish with a pinch of apple pie spice blend
Instructions
Preheat oven to 350°F. Line a large baking tray with parchment paper or a silicone mat. Set aside.
In a medium-sized bowl stir together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and apple pie spice blend.
In a large mixing bowl, using a handheld mixer on medium-low speed, cream together the butter and light brown sugar for 1 minute or until light and fluffy. Add the eggs, one at a time, until completely incorporated.
Add the vanilla extract and the applesauce and mix for another minute.
At a low speed, combine your flour mixture with your butter mixture for another 1-2 minutes or just until all the flour is incorporated. Do not over mix your batter.
Using a 1½ tablespoon (1.5-inch) cookie scoop, scoop out your batter onto the prepared baking tray 2 inches apart. Bake for 10-12 minutes or just until lightly golden on the edges. Once your cookies have baked, allow them to cool on the tray for 5 minutes then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ely before frosting them.
While your cookies are baking and cooling you can make your frosting. In a medium-sized mixing bowl beat together, on medium speed with a handheld mixer, the softened cream cheese and powdered sugar for 2 minutes. Add the vanilla extract and half & half and combine until smooth. You can add a little more half & half if your mixture is not soft and spreadable but not too much because you want your frosting to hold its shape.
Once your cookies have cooled completely you can frost them with about a tablespoon of the frosting per cookie and sprinkle them with a pinch of the apple pie spice.
Notes
TIP: If your grocery store does not have an apple spice blend you can create your own by combining 1 teaspoon cinnamon, 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g, and ¼ teaspoon ground cloves. Mix well.
TIP: Don’t worry if it looks like your batter is separating because when you add the flour mixture it will come back together.

Recipe: Yield 6-8 cookies
1 C Oats
1/2 C regular applesauce or 3/4 C applesauce if chunky
Added to 2nd batch:
2 T Dried cranberries
1 tsp Chia seeds
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Mix ingredients well. On a greased baking sheet or parchment paper, squeeze and roll into 2-inch balls, and flatten with your hands or a spatula. Chill in the fridge for 20 minutes to keep the shape. Bake 20-30 minutes (depending on thickness) until toasty edges. Let cool completely. Seal in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 weeks or freeze for longer term.

A Chewy Oatmeal Raisin Cookie You're Going to Love
This is my favorite recipe for classic oatmeal raisin cookies! They're richly flavored, perfectly soft and chewy, and SO easy to make--no mixer required!
Recipe:
Ingredients
1 cup unsalted butter, melted and cooled until no longer warm to the touch (226g)
1 cup dark brown sugar, firmly packed (200g)
½ cup granulated sugar (100g)
¾ teaspoon ground cinnamon
2 large eggs, room temperature preferred
1 Tablespoon molasses (use a molasses that says “unsulphured” on the label, I like “Grandmas” and “Brer Rabbit” brand)
1 Tablespoon vanilla extract
2 cups all-purpose flour (250g)
1 Tablespoon cornstarch
1 teaspoon baking soda
¾ teaspoon table salt
3 cups old-fashioned rolled oats (290g)
1 ½ cups raisins (225g)

Instructions
00:00 Introduction
00:20 In a large mixing bowl, combine melted, cooled butter, sugars, and cinnamon and stir until well-combined.
00:57 Add eggs and stir well, then stir in molasses and vanilla extract until completely combined.
01:28 In a separate mixing bowl, whisk together flour, cornstarch, baking soda and salt.
01:45 Gradually stir dry ingredients into butter mixture until completely combined.
01:58 Add oats and raisins and stir until oats and raisins are uniformly distributed.
02:20 Cover dough with plastic wrap and refrigerate for 30-60 minutes before baking (see note if you would like to chill longer).
02:33 Once dough is nearly finished chilling, preheat oven to 350F (175C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
03:37 Once dough has finished chilling, remove from refrigerator and scoop into rounded 1 1/2-Tablespoon sized scoops. Drop scoops onto prepared baking sheet, spacing cookies at least 2” (5cm) apart.
02:57 Bake on 350F (175C) for 10-12 minutes. The centers will look slightly underbaked still but allow the cookies to cool completely on the baking sheet and they will finish cooking to perfection, leaving you with soft, chewy cookies.
Notes
Making dough in advance
This cookie dough may be made up to 5 days in advance of baking, simply store it tightly covered in the refrigerator until ready to use. Note that the dough becomes quite firm if it sits longer than 1 hour, so you may need to let it sit at room temperature for 15-20 minutes or so before it is easy to scoop. Cookie dough may also be scooped, wrapped tightly, and frozen in an airtight container for up to 3 months.
Storing
Store in an airtight container at room temperature. Cookies will stay fresh for at least 5 days.

Healthy Peanut Butter Oatmeal Cookies - 2 ways
This is one of my favorite recipes. I hope you like it.
►►►►►►►►►►WRITTEN RECIPE►►►►►►►►►►
Ingredients
1st Method:
1 Egg
2 tbsp Honey
1/2 cup Peanut Butter
1/2 cup Oats
2nd Method:
1 Egg
2 tbsp Honey
1 cup Peanut Butter
1/2 cup Oats Flour
Directions
1st Method:
Whisk egg, honey and peanut butter.
Once the peanut butter is blended well, add oats and blend well.
Take small amount and give a cookies shape. Place it on baking tray.
Bake in pre-heated oven for 15-20 minutes.
I would suggest to bake 10 minutes and check in between.
2nd Method:
Grind Oats in a blender to make Oats Flour.
Whisk egg, honey and peanut butter.
Once the peanut butter is blended well, add oats flour and blend well.
Take small amount and give a cookies shape. Place it on baking tray.
Bake in pre-heated oven for 20-25 minutes.
I would suggest to bake 10 minutes and check in between.
